WebApr 10, 2024 · Reading and Writing Binary Data. Use the HDFS connector hdfs:SequenceFile profile when you want to read or write SequenceFile format data to HDFS. Files of this type consist of binary key/value pairs. SequenceFile format is a common data transfer format between MapReduce jobs. Web2 days ago · A binary literal is a number that is denoted using binary digits that are 0s and 1s. The values written in data types – byte, int, long, and short can be easily expressed in a binary number system. The prefix 0b or 0B is added to the integer to declare a binary literal. Example WebSep 20, 2024 · A binary file doesn’t have an end-of-file character because any such character would be indistinguishable from a binary datum. Generally speaking, the steps involved in reading and writing binary files are the same as for text files: Connect a stream to the file. Read or write the data, possibly using a loop. Close the stream.
